# Matching Engine Restarts
> Maintenance windows, restart handling, and post-restart post-only mode
The Polymarket matching engine undergoes restarts for maintenance and upgrades. This page covers how to detect and handle downtime, the post-restart post-only period, and where to get advance notice of changes.

## Announcements
Matching engine changes — planned restarts, updates, and maintenance windows — are announced **before they happen** in these channels:
Join the Polymarket Trading APIs channel for real-time announcements.
Join the #trading-apis channel in the Polymarket Discord.
Announcements typically include **what's changing**, the **scheduled time**, and the **expected downtime window**. The goal is \~2 days notice when possible.

## Handling HTTP 425
During a restart window, the CLOB API returns **HTTP 425 (Too Early)** on all order-related endpoints. This tells your client that the matching engine is restarting and will be back shortly.
After every restart, the matching engine enters **post-only mode for 2 minutes**. During this period, cancels are accepted and new orders must use `postOnly: true`; non-post-only orders are rejected.
### Recommended Retry Strategy
When you receive an HTTP `425` response, the matching engine is restarting. Do not treat this as a permanent error.
Wait and retry with exponential backoff. Start at 1–2 seconds and increase the interval on each retry.
Once `425` responses stop, the engine is back online but remains in post-only mode for 2 minutes. During that period, only cancels and orders with `postOnly: true` are accepted.
### Code Examples
Check the HTTP status code on responses to the CLOB API and retry on `425`:
```typescript TypeScript theme={null}
const CLOB_HOST = "https://clob.polymarket.com";
async function postWithRetry(path: string, body: any, headers: Record) {
const MAX_RETRIES = 10;
let delay = 1000;
for (let attempt = 0; attempt < MAX_RETRIES; attempt++) {
const response = await fetch(`${CLOB_HOST}${path}`, {
method: "POST",
headers: { "Content-Type": "application/json", ...headers },
body: JSON.stringify(body),
});
if (response.status === 425) {
console.log(`Engine restarting, retrying in ${delay / 1000}s...`);
await new Promise((r) => setTimeout(r, delay));
delay = Math.min(delay * 2, 30000);
continue;
}
return response;
}
throw new Error("Engine restart exceeded maximum retry attempts");
}
```
```python Python theme={null}
import time
import requests
CLOB_HOST = "https://clob.polymarket.com"
def post_with_retry(path, body, headers, max_retries=10):
delay = 1
for attempt in range(max_retries):
response = requests.post(
f"{CLOB_HOST}{path}",
json=body,
headers=headers,
)
if response.status_code == 425:
print(f"Engine restarting, retrying in {delay}s...")
time.sleep(delay)
delay = min(delay * 2, 30)
continue
return response
raise Exception("Engine restart exceeded maximum retry attempts")
```
```rust Rust theme={null}
use polymarket_client_sdk_v2::error::{Kind, StatusCode};
// Wrap SDK calls with retry logic for HTTP 425.
// Re-build and re-sign the order each attempt since SignedOrder is consumed.
let mut delay = std::time::Duration::from_secs(1);
for _ in 0..10 {
let order = client.limit_order()
.token_id(token_id).price(price).size(size).side(side)
.build().await?;
let signed = client.sign(&signer, order).await?;
match client.post_order(signed).await {
Ok(response) => return Ok(response),
Err(err) if err.kind() == Kind::Status => {
if let Some(status) = err.downcast_ref::() {
if status.status_code == StatusCode::from_u16(425).unwrap() {
eprintln!("Engine restarting, retrying in {delay:?}...");
tokio::time::sleep(delay).await;
delay = (delay * 2).min(std::time::Duration::from_secs(30));
continue;
}
}
return Err(err);
}
Err(err) => return Err(err),
}
}
```

## Restricted Trading Modes
During restricted trading modes, order placement behavior changes for `POST /order` and `POST /orders`. Cancel endpoints continue to accept cancels unless trading is fully disabled.
### Cancel-Only Mode
In cancel-only mode, new orders are rejected, but cancel requests are still accepted.
`POST /order` and `POST /orders` return `503`:
```json theme={null}
{
"error": "Trading is currently cancel-only. New orders are not accepted, but cancels are allowed."
}
```
### Post-Only Mode
After every restart, the matching engine enters post-only mode for **2 minutes**. Cancel requests are accepted and new orders must use `postOnly: true`. Non-post-only orders are rejected.
`POST /order` returns `503` with a retry delay in both the response body and the `Retry-After` HTTP header:
```json theme={null}
{
"error": "post-only mode: only post-only orders and cancels are allowed",
"code": "post_only_mode",
"retry_after_seconds": 79
}
```
`POST /orders` returns per-order errors for non-post-only orders in the batch:
```json theme={null}
[
{
"errorMsg": "post-only mode: only post-only orders and cancels are allowed",
"orderID": "",
"takingAmount": "",
"makingAmount": "",
"status": "",
"success": true
},
{
"errorMsg": "post-only mode: only post-only orders and cancels are allowed",
"orderID": "",
"takingAmount": "",
"makingAmount": "",
"status": "",
"success": true
}
]
```
When you receive either restricted-mode response, do not retry the same non-post-only order unchanged. Cancel existing orders, retry after the indicated delay when one is provided, or resubmit eligible maker orders with `postOnly: true`.

## Best Practices
* **Subscribe to announcement channels** — get notified before restarts happen so you can prepare
* **Handle 425 gracefully** — treat it as a temporary condition, not an error; your retry logic should resume automatically
* **Handle 503 mode responses on order placement** — cancel-only and post-only responses require changing order flow, not blind retrying
* **Avoid aggressive retries** — the engine needs time to reload orderbooks; rapid-fire retries won't speed things up and may hit rate limits once the engine is back
* **Log restart events** — track when your client encounters 425s to correlate with announced maintenance windows
